  • California Code of Civil Procedure section 335.1

    Primary statutory text for the general two-year personal-injury action period; on this page it frames overloaded truck accidents record questions connecting Huntington Beach Hospital with Orange County Superior Court - Harbor Justice Center; verify the timeline against independent corroboration to show what needs confirmation.

    Limit: Exceptions, accrual rules, contract terms, public-entity claims, and other laws may change the applicable deadline.

  • California Government Code section 911.2

    Primary statutory text for specified claims presented to a public entity; on this page it frames overloaded truck accidents record questions connecting Huntington Beach Hospital with Orange County Superior Court - Harbor Justice Center; trace the filing question against official authority to distinguish context from proof.

    Limit: The statute does not identify whether a defendant is a public entity or whether another presentation rule applies.

Service-specific proof

What changes in a overloaded truck accidents review

Overloaded-truck cases frequently involve the shipper, broker, loading company, or warehouse, not just the driver or carrier.

  • Bills of lading, scale tickets, and cargo manifests.
  • Photos of trailer load balance, securement, and cargo movement.
  • Dispatch instructions showing who controlled the load and deadline pressure.
